Now, these are reasonable, great, and necessary goals for launching any new business. It’s what I have done for my former Kids Yoga business and my current Coaching company—as well, I have helped hundreds of solopreneurs and small business founders to execute, too.
However, after two months of coaching, Janey is learning that starting up her business requires more than these foundational practical pieces. She’s realizing that launching her business is more than just checking tactical boxes.
Janey is appreciating that in order to build her business well—including creating something that is authentic to her, having a clear and aligned vision, and having consistent Self-care along the way—the formation of her new business has to include inner-work, too.
It must!
Why?
Because when you set out to do something big like Janey who is starting up her dream business—or you are growing your current business to its next level—it’s likely going to kick up your sh*t.
It’s likely going to have you feeling your fear and asking yourself, “What if no one likes my ideas?”
It’s likely going to have you facing your doubt and asking yourself, “What do I have to offer that is different from anyone else?”
It’s likely going to have you encountering your imposter syndrome and asking yourself, “What if I get caught seeming like I don’t know what I am doing?”
Your fear, doubt, and imposter syndrome are all a normal part of starting any business (and growing one too!) Heck, they are a normal part of being human!
